[ad_1] In a recent development, the Karnataka government has banned the use of colours in food items like gobi Manchurian and cotton candy, citing health concerns. According to the state government, these food colours often contain agents like Rhodamine-B, which is considered "harmful and unsafe". However, ruling out a complete ban on the food items across the state, Karnataka Health Minister Dinesh Gundurao released an order, stating that strict actions will be taken against the eateries, found to be using artificial colours in the preparation of gobi Manchurian and cotton candy.The order further stated that any kind of violation would draw "at least seven years in prison and a fine of Rs. 10 lakh".
